1 Call for Papers * International Symposion of the Institute of Philosophy, Zagreb in Hvar, Croatia. October 9-13, 2006 Platonism and Forms of Intelligence / Le platonisme et les formes d'intelligence / Platonismus und Formen der Intelligenz / Il platonismo e le forme dell'intelligenza What forms does intelligence take? How does it enable us to know, to feel and to act? The Platonic doctrine of ideas or forms has its roots in a comprehensive understanding of the activity of human intelligence, of its ability to access and utilize the contents of experience in order to establish a coherent view of reality, direct our decisions and behaviour and inspire our creative productivity. From its inception in the presocratic paradigmata of Platonic thought to its modern representatives in rationalist and idealist philosophy, Platonism and those thinkers closely associated with Platonism - among them, Plato, Aristotle, Plotinus, Nicolas Cusanus, Spinoza, Schelling, Hegel and Franz von Baader - have differentiated levels and types of human intelligence: receptive and (re-)productive or spontaneous, intentional and conceptual, argumentative or discursive and intuitive or analogical - recognizing the distinct importance of each and the proportionality expressed by their interconnections, their intercommunication and their mutual cooperation. For Plato and the Platonists, epistemology is not separate from ontology, knowledge from reality, because cognition itself is recognized as the most essential aspect of reality. At the same time, for Platonism, intelligence represents the unique means by which we approach and attain to reality, both the reality which intelligence itself is and that to which it refers. In distinguishing various levels of cognition and their specific modes of (co-)operation and intercommunication, Platonist philosophy thus recognizes and differentiates an inherent diversity in the quality and content of experience, i.e. specific aspects of reality corresponding to each aspect of intelligence and specific ways in which we approach and utilize the different aspects of reality which each individually and all in their entirety convey. The Platonic theory of intelligence played a determining role in the development of scientific method (by defining the role of hypothesis and experiment in the investigation of phenomena; by differentiating between observation and explanation, deduction and argument, reasons and causes). In their reflections on the relationship of intelligence and its objects, Platonist philosophers also anticipate many of the most significant theoretical advances of modern scientific theory (for example, the theory of relativity and the principle of indeterminacy). Platonist views on intelligence can be shown, furthermore, to have had a marked influence on Kant and a number of other ostensible counterexamples to Platonic philosophy, providing a unique opportunity to more fully comprehend the genuine import of those systems of thought. Not only in a methodological or historical sense, however, do Platonic views on intelligence prove relevant to current research. Fundamental research in the physical and life sciences tends to confirm the Platonic "analogy of intelligence", i.e. the heuristic and paradigmatic role of something like human intelligence for an understanding of the genesis and structure of the universe as well as of the emergence and organisation of the individual beings which comprise it. Finally, recent investigation into the role certain types of intelligence play in artistic production and art appreciation provides its own form of experimental evidence for the Platonist view of the interconnectivity and intercommunication of gradual and hierarchical levels of intelligence. 4 Platonizam i oblici inteligencije listopada 2006, Grad Hvar, Hrvatska Koje oblike uzima inteligencija? Kako nam omogućuje spoznavati, osjećati i djelovati? Kako se inteligencija pokazuje izvan mislećeg subjekta i njegovih svjesnih čina? Gledano iz neurofiziološke perspektive, samosvjesne funkcije inteligencije oslanjaju se na mnoštvo nesvjesnih mehanizama. Time se pokazuje kako sama inteligencija u svom djelovanju nadilazi pojedinačne čine naše subjektivne refleksije, kao i sveukupnost ljudske intencionalnosti. Nadilazeći puko nabrajanje elemenata spoznaje, istraživanje prirode inteligencije zato nužno mora uključiti nešto poput Kantovog transcendentalnog pristupa, propitkivanje uvjeta mogućnosti, dovodeći na taj način pod svjetlo filozofijske refleksije onaj dio inteligencije koji obično ne ulazi u područje našeg samosvjesnog iskustva. Svojim istraživanjem naravi i mogućnosti spoznaje Platon i filozofija platonizma postigli su obuhvatno razumijevanje ljudske inteligencije, njene sposobnosti pristupanja sadržaju iskustva i uporabe tog iskustva u cilju uspostavljanja koherentnog pogleda na stvarnost, usmjeravanja naših odluka i ponašanja, i inspiriranja našeg kreativnog stvaralaštva. Kao filozofska tradicija platonizam se također oduvijek pokazivao otvorenim prema raznolikim načinima na koje se inteligencija manifestira izvan subjektivne samosvijesti u biljnom i životinjskom svijetu, u proizvodima ljudskog stvaralaštva, u prirodi i svemiru, u snovima, mitovima i drugim kolektivnim pojavama ljudske kulture. Od svojih početaka u predsokratovskim paradigmama platoničkog mišljenja do svojih modernih predstavnika unutar filozofije racionalizma i idealizma, platonizam i mislitelji blisko povezani s platonizmom među njima Platon, Aristotel, Plotin, Nikola Kuzanski, Spinoza, Schelling, Hegel i Franz von Baader razlikovali su stupnjeve i tipove ljudske inteligencije, subjektivne ili samosvjesne i»objektivne«ili nesvjesne, receptivne i reproduktivne ili spontane, diskurzivne i intuitivne, pojedinačne i kolektivne ili opće prepoznajući istaknutu važnost svake od njih, i karakterističnu proporcionalnost (te obzirom na određene predmete djelomičnu disproporcionalnost) njihovih međusobnih odnosa i stvarnosti koju pokušavaju izraziti. Za Platona i platoničare sama spoznaja predstavlja najbitniji aspekt stvarnosti, a inteligencija istovremeno jedinstveno sredstvo pomoću kojeg dosežemo stvarnost koju predstavlja sama inteligencija. U razlikovanju stupnjeva i tipova inteligencije platonička filozofija tako prepoznaje inherentu različitost u kvaliteti i sadržaju ljudskog iskustva, obogaćujući time to iskustvo i omogućavajući nam otkrivanje novih pristupa u rješavanju čitavog niza problema i pitanja s kojima se u današnjem svijetu suočavamo.
